- Note
- "Boston, July 15, 1808. At a meeting of the Committee of the Africans and Descendants of Africans in Boston, voted--that Fortune Symmes, Peter Guest, and Cyrus Vassall, be a committee to wait on the Rev. Dr. Morse, and in the name of 'The African Society,' to thank him for his discourse delivered before them, at their request, on the subject of the 'abolition of the slave-trade,' and request a copy for the press. Cyrus Vassall, secretary."--page [4].
